XRP’s Legal Woes: Ripple CEO Slams SEC Over Token’s Status

- Ripple’s legal case with the SEC continues to impact XRP’s performance in the market.
- Bitnomial sued the SEC, arguing XRP should be treated as a commodity, not a security.
- The SEC’s intervention blocked Bitnomial from offering XRP futures on its platform.
Ripple Labs continues to face legal pressure from the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). This ongoing battle has affected the performance of its native token, XRP. While other cryptocurrencies have seen notable gains, XRP has lagged behind.
The primary issue is the uncertainty over whether XRP should be classified as a security or a commodity. This legal uncertainty has caused investors to remain cautious, holding back the token’s growth compared to its peers.

Ripple CEO Criticizes SEC
It is important to note that Bitnomial’s lawsuit, filed on October 10 in Illinois, escalates the ongoing tension between Ripple and the SEC. The exchange received CFTC approval in 2020 to offer cryptocurrency futures. While the SEC deemed XRP as a security and XRP futures as security futures, it hindered Bitnomial’s way to offering XRP futures.
Bitnomial particularly presented its case before the SEC explaining why XRP should be considered as a commodity and not a security. In its argument, the exchange stated that XRP futures should fall under the jurisdiction of the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C).

The SEC has been met with a lot of criticism especially from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se. Garlinghouse criticized the SEC, calling it a “renegade agency” after Bitnomial’s filing. He stated Ripple is considering its own actions to hold the SEC accountable for ignoring the court’s ruling that XRP is not a security.
